The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the UK excluding London with a requirement for knowledge and experience of VMware products and/or services.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ited VMware over the 6 months to 9 June 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

The figures below represent the IT labour market in general and are not representative of salaries within VMware, Inc.

6 months to
9 Jun 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 71 74 85
Rank change year-on-year +3 +11 -38
Permanent jobs citing VMware 2,681 2,446 2,848
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K excluding London 3.39% 4.39% 3.76%
As % of the Vendors category 10.27% 10.52% 9.51%
Number of salaries quoted 2,182 1,674 2,166
10th Percentile £27,750 £28,750 £28,000
25th Percentile £34,500 £35,000 £32,750
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£42,500 £45,000 £45,000
Median % change year-on-year -5.56% - +5.88%
75th Percentile £55,000 £57,500 £53,750
90th Percentile £63,750 £68,165 £65,000
UK median annual salary £45,000 £50,000 £50,000
% change year-on-year -10.00% - +8.70%
